Expertise and Experience
The first and foremost aspect to consider when choosing a doctor for Thermage in Arima is their expertise and experience in performing the procedure. A qualified doctor should have extensive knowledge of skin anatomy and a proven track record of successful Thermage treatments. It is advisable to look for doctors who are board-certified in dermatology or plastic surgery and have specific training in Thermage techniques. Reviewing before-and-after photos of previous patients can provide valuable insights into the doctor's skill and the outcomes they can achieve.

Consultation Process
A thorough consultation is an essential step in the process of choosing a doctor for Thermage. During the consultation, the doctor should assess your skin condition, discuss your goals, and explain the procedure in detail. This is an opportunity to ask questions and understand the potential risks and benefits of Thermage. A knowledgeable doctor will provide honest advice and tailor the treatment plan to meet your specific needs. Pay attention to how well the doctor listens and whether they address all your concerns.

FAQ
Q: How long does a Thermage treatment take?
A: A typical Thermage treatment session can last from 30 minutes to two hours, depending on the area being treated.
Q: Is Thermage painful?
A: Most patients experience minimal discomfort during Thermage. The procedure involves controlled heating of the skin, and some patients may feel a warm sensation. Cooling mechanisms in the device help manage any discomfort.
Q: How soon will I see results from Thermage?
A: Some patients notice an immediate improvement, but the full effects of Thermage become more evident over a period of two to six months as the collagen in the skin continues to tighten and regenerate.
Q: How long do the results of Thermage last?
A: The results of Thermage can last for several years. However, individual outcomes may vary based on factors such as age, skin condition, and lifestyle.
Q: Are there any side effects associated with Thermage?
A: Thermage is generally safe, but some patients may experience temporary redness, swelling, or minor discomfort. These side effects typically resolve within a few days.
